How are artificial intelligence systems classified?

Reader donghungxxx@gmail asks: How are artificial intelligence systems classified according to new regulations?

Legal Consulting Office of Lao Dong Newspaper answers:

Article 6, Decree 142/2026/ND-CP detailing a number of articles and measures to implement the Law on Artificial Intelligence (effective from May 1, 2026), stipulates the classification of artificial intelligence systems as follows:

1. The provider is responsible for performing the classification of the artificial intelligence system in accordance with the provisions of Clause 1, Article 10 of the Law on Artificial Intelligence before putting the system into use and is responsible before the law for the accuracy and truthfulness of the classification results.

2. The classification specified in this Article only applies to artificial intelligence systems; does not apply to artificial intelligence models, except in cases where the model is used as a component of a specific artificial intelligence system.

3. The level of risk of artificial intelligence systems is determined as follows:

a) Artificial intelligence systems classified as high-risk are systems belonging to the List of high-risk artificial intelligence systems promulgated by the Prime Minister according to the provisions of Clause 4, Article 13 of the Law on Artificial Intelligence;

b) Artificial intelligence systems classified as having average risk are systems that do not fall into the cases specified in point a of this clause and fall into the cases specified in Article 9 of this Decree;

c) Artificial intelligence systems classified as low-risk are systems that do not fall into the cases specified in points a and b of this clause.

4. In case the implementing party amends, integrates, changes the function or purpose of use of the system compared to the initial announcement of the provider, causing new or higher risks, the implementing party is responsible for coordinating with the provider to review and reclassify the level of risk.

Thus, from May 1, 2026, the artificial intelligence system is classified according to the above regulations.
